After teaching the mother about follow-up immunizations for her daughter, who received varicella vaccine at age 14 months, the nurse determines that the teaching was successful when the mother states that a follow-up dose should be given at which

time?
A) When the child is 20 to 36 months of age
B) When the child is 4 to 6 years of age
C) When the child is 11 to 12 years of age
D) When the child is 13 to 15 years of age


B
